Tourists Like Us! They Really, Really Like Us!
According to statistics from the Illinois Department of Commerce and Economic Opportunity, the amount of money tourists spent in the state was up in 2008 by nearly a billion dollars ($883 million, to be exact) for a grand total of $30.8 billion. Overall, the state also saw a 21-percent increase in visitors from overseas (1.4 million overall). While the number of tourists hitting our fair city declined by 2.1 percent over 2007's record-setting year (a total of 44.21 million) but the good news (besides the fact we're Johnny Depp's favorite U.S. city) is that they spent a little bit more time here than they did in 2007.
